🎯 개요
Mintlify는 개발자가 코드를 기반으로 기술 문서를 손쉽게 생성하고 관리할 수 있도록 돕는 AI 기반 문서화 플랫폼입니다. 개발 과정에서 늘 뒷전으로 밀리거나, 최신 코드와 동기화되지 못해 골칫덩어리가 되곤 하는 문서화의 고질적인 문제를 해결하기 위해 등장했습니다. 이 서비스는 AI를 활용하여 코드 분석부터 문서 초안 생성, 그리고 호스팅까지 원스톱으로 제공하며, 특히 개발팀의 생산성과 문서의 일관성 유지에 초점을 맞추고 있습니다. 복잡한 설정 없이 간결하고 직관적인 워크플로우를 제공하여, 개발자들이 문서화에 들이는 시간을 최소화하고 핵심 개발에 집중할 수 있도록 지원합니다.
🌐 공식 사이트 & 시작하기
아래는 Mintlify 공식 사이트 URL입니다. 웹사이트에서 데모를 확인하거나 가입하여 서비스를 직접 체험할 수 있습니다.
공식 링크: https://mintlify.com/
GitHub 계정으로 간편하게 가입하고, 기존 코드 저장소와 연동하여 AI 문서 생성을 시작할 수 있습니다. 몇 분 내에 기본적인 문서 사이트를 구축하는 것이 가능합니다.
🔑 주요 기능
- AI 기반 문서 생성 및 업데이트: Mintlify의 핵심 기능은 AI가 코드 스니펫, 함수, 클래스 등을 분석하여 마크다운 형식의 문서 초안을 자동으로 생성하는 것입니다. 단순히 텍스트를 생성하는 것을 넘어, 코드 변경 사항을 감지하여 관련 문서 업데이트를 제안하거나 자동으로 적용할 수 있습니다. 예를 들어, 신규 API 엔드포인트가 추가되거나 기존 함수의 파라미터가 변경될 경우, AI가 해당 변경 사항을 즉시 반영한 문서 초안을 생성하여 개발자가 수동으로 문서를 수정하는 번거로움을 크게 줄여줍니다.
- 통합된 문서 호스팅 및 검색: 생성된 문서는 Mintlify 플랫폼 내에서 직접 호스팅되며, 커스텀 도메인 설정, 버전 관리, 강력한 풀텍스트 검색 기능 등을 기본으로 제공합니다. 이는 단순한 문서 생성 도구를 넘어, 개발자를 위한 완벽한 문서 포털을 구축할 수 있게 해줍니다. 팀원이나 사용자가 필요한 정보를 쉽고 빠르게 찾아볼 수 있도록 지원하여, 정보 접근성을 크게 향상시킵니다.
- Git 통합 및 협업 워크플로우: GitHub, GitLab 등의 Git 저장소와 긴밀하게 통합되어 있습니다. 개발자가 코드를 푸시하면 CI/CD 파이프라인의 일부로 문서가 자동 빌드 및 배포되도록 설정할 수 있습니다. 또한, 여러 개발자가 동시에 문서 작업을 할 수 있는 협업 기능을 제공하여, 문서화 과정 또한 개발 워크플로우의 자연스러운 일부로 녹아들게 합니다. 이는 문서의 실시간 동기화를 보장하고, 개발팀 전체의 효율적인 협업을 가능하게 합니다.
👍 장점
- 획기적인 생산성 향상: 개발자들이 가장 어려워하는 문서 초안 작성 및 초기 구조 설계에 AI가 개입하여 엄청난 시간을 절약할 수 있습니다. 레거시 코드의 문서화가 필요할 때, AI가 코드 구조를 파악해 빠르게 초안을 만들어주어 기존에 며칠이 걸리던 문서화 작업을 몇 시간으로 단축할 수 있었습니다. 이를 통해 개발팀은 코드 품질 향상과 핵심 기능 구현에 더욱 집중할 수 있습니다.
- 일관된 문서 품질 유지: AI가 생성하는 문서는 표준화된 템플릿과 스타일 가이드를 기반으로 하여, 팀 전체의 문서가 일관된 품질을 유지하도록 돕습니다. 여러 개발자가 각기 다른 스타일로 문서를 작성하여 발생하는 혼란을 방지하고, 사용자에게 전문적이고 신뢰할 수 있는 정보를 제공할 수 있습니다.
- 쉬운 유지보수 및 최신성 확보: 코드 변경에 따라 문서가 자동으로 업데이트되거나 업데이트를 제안하므로, 문서가 코드와 동떨어져 구식이 되는 문제를 방지합니다. Git과의 긴밀한 통합 덕분에 코드 베이스와 문서를 항상 최신 상태로 유지하는 것이 용이하며, 문서 유지보수 부담을 크게 줄여줍니다.
👎 단점
- 가격 정책의 부담: 개인 개발자나 소규모 오픈소스 프로젝트의 경우, 무료 티어가 존재하지만 모든 AI 기능을 활용하거나 팀 규모가 커질수록 유료 플랜의 비용이 부담될 수 있습니다. 특히 예산이 제한적인 프로젝트에는 진입 장벽으로 작용할 수 있습니다.
- AI 의존성과 검토 필요성: AI가 생성하는 문서가 항상 완벽한 것은 아니므로, 복잡하거나 매우 특화된 도메인 지식이 필요한 부분에서는 개발자의 꼼꼼한 검토와 수정이 필수적입니다. AI가 때때로 일반적이거나 맥락에 맞지 않는 내용을 생성할 수 있어, 최종본을 신뢰하기 전에는 항상 사람이 직접 확인해야 합니다.
- 커스터마이징의 한계: 문서 사이트의 디자인이나 특정 UI/UX 요구사항이 매우 강한 팀의 경우, Mintlify가 제공하는 템플릿과 스타일 안에서만 커스터마이징이 가능하기 때문에 제한적으로 느껴질 수 있습니다. 완전히 독자적인 브랜딩이나 디자인을 추구하는 경우 유연성이 부족하다고 느낄 수 있습니다.
🎯 추천 대상
- 새로운 프로젝트를 시작하거나 빠르게 성장하는 스타트업의 개발팀
- 방대한 코드 베이스를 효율적으로 문서화하고 싶은 소프트웨어 개발팀
- 오픈소스 프로젝트의 문서화 부담을 줄이고 싶은 관리자
- API나 SDK 문서를 최신 상태로 유지하고 싶은 개발자
🔮 결론
Mintlify는 개발 문서화의 오랜 숙제를 AI 기술로 해결하며, 개발팀의 생산성을 한 단계 끌어올릴 잠재력을 가진 서비스입니다. 단순히 문서를 생성하는 것을 넘어, 개발 워크플로우와 긴밀하게 통합되어 코드 기반 문서화의 효율을 극대화합니다. 문서 유지보수의 부담을 줄이고자 하는 개발팀이라면 Mintlify가 제공하는 혁신적인 가치를 충분히 경험할 수 있을 것입니다.
👉 더 자세한 정보는 공식 사이트에서 확인할 수 있다:
https://mintlify.com/
🔗 Focus Keyphrase
Mintlify 리뷰
📝 Slug
mintlify-ai-documentation-review
📜 Meta Description
AI 기반 문서화 플랫폼 Mintlify 리뷰. 코드로부터 고품질 문서를 자동으로 생성하여 개발팀의 문서 작성 시간을 획기적으로 줄이고, 일관된 기술 문서를 유지하도록 돕습니다.